Summary
Requires State Department of Energy in consultation with Department of Consumer and Business Services to specify energy performance standard for covered commercial buildings that seeks to maximize reductions in greenhouse gas emissions, includes energy use intensity targets that apply to specific types of buildings and that provides for methods to achieve conditional compliance. Requires Department of Consumer and Business Services to study how to build resiliency and efficiency into buildings. Specifies requirements for State Department of Energy and discretion that department may exercise in specifying energy performance standard and developing energy use intensity targets. Requires department to notify eligible building owners concerning energy performance standard and energy use intensity targets and allows department to approve eligible building owner's use of conditional compliance method in lieu of full compliance. Permits municipality to adopt energy performance standard and greenhouse gas emission reduction standards that are more stringent or have broader application than department's standard or targets. Requires eligible building owners to report to department concerning compliance with energy performance standard. Specifies required contents of reports. Requires department to provide support program with information, training, technical assistance and telephone and electronic mail support for meeting energy use intensity targets. Specifies dates by which eligible building owners must comply with energy performance standard. Permits department to impose civil penalty for failure to comply. Directs department to establish requirement and standard under which specified eligible building owners must provide data that would allow department to set benchmark for energy use in and greenhouse gas emissions from certain covered commercial buildings. Requires department to establish program to pay incentives to eligible building owners to encourage compliance with energy performance standard. Permits department to contract with another person to administer payments. Specifies qualifications for and rates of payment. Declares emergency, effective on passage.
